Illustrator and writer Ludwig Volbeda in House of the book in The Hague

From 8 March to 24 August 2025, House of the book will present the exhibition ‘Huis van Ludwig Volbeda’ (House of Ludwig Volbeda), which focuses on the work and inner world of Dutch illustrator and writer Ludwig Volbeda. The exhibition offers a glimpse into his overflowing sketchbooks, which serve as a hub for his fascinations and ideas. The exhibition not only honours Volbeda’s work, but also the power of curiosity and imagination.

On display are original drawings where the attentive visitor can recognise the characters, locations and atmosphere of some of the well-known books he illustrated, such as De vogels (The birds) by Ted van Lieshout, Fabeldieren (Mythical creatures) by Floortje Zwigtman and Hele verhalen voor een halve soldaat (Complete stories for a half soldier) by Benny Lindelauf. With hundreds of miniature drawings from his personal archive, Volbeda invites the visitor into his imaginary realm. Through hands-on assignments he also challenges visitors to come up with and draw themselves. As such, ‘Huis van Ludwig Volbeda’ is more than an exhibition. This spring and summer, Ludwig Volbeda will give workshops and guided tours through his sketchbooks, and will also curate the 2025 ‘Illustrators’ Day’ at House of the book.

Ludwig Volbeda, award-winning illustrator and writer

Ludwig Volbeda (1990) became known as an illustrator of children’s books. His work is characterised by a detailed and layered visual language that invites careful viewing and discovery. In his work, he combines major life questions with everyday details. In 2018 and 2021, he received a ‘Golden Brush’ (Gouden Penseel) for the books Fabeldieren and Hele verhalen voor een halve soldaat. In 2024, Volbeda made his debut as a writer with the youth novel Oever, which was named Rainbow book of the year 2024 (Regenboogboek van het jaar 2024) and is currently on the shortlist for the Flemish Boon Youth Literature prize (Vlaamse Jeugdliteratuurprijs).

Series ‘House of …’ in House of the Book

The collaboration with illustrator and writer Ludwig Volbeda is the first in a series of ‘House of …’ in which changing artists in residence are invited to take over a floor of the museum and take visitors into the House of their art.

Myths and Possibilities

Starting from 8 March, the exhibition Myths and Possibilities will also be on view at House of the book, where the museum uses books and visual art to explore humanity’s search for alternative worlds. The world of Ludwig Volbeda is one of the featured worlds in the museum.
